2 lines
9.5 KiB
JavaScript
2 lines
9.5 KiB
JavaScript
"use strict";(self.webpackChunk=self.webpackChunk||[]).push([[3824],{79501:function(Z,C,o){var l=o(23862);C.Z=l.Z},70151:function(Z,C,o){var l=o(93236);const I=(0,l.createContext)({});C.Z=I},23862:function(Z,C,o){var l=o(84875),I=o.n(l),y=o(93236),W=o(81731),B=o(70151),M=o(82678),U=function(e,c){var $={};for(var t in e)Object.prototype.hasOwnProperty.call(e,t)&&c.indexOf(t)<0&&($[t]=e[t]);if(e!=null&&typeof Object.getOwnPropertySymbols=="function")for(var n=0,t=Object.getOwnPropertySymbols(e);n<t.length;n++)c.indexOf(t[n])<0&&Object.prototype.propertyIsEnumerable.call(e,t[n])&&($[t[n]]=e[t[n]]);return $};function F(e){return typeof e=="number"?`${e} ${e} auto`:/^\d+(\.\d+)?(px|em|rem|%)$/.test(e)?`0 0 ${e}`:e}const G=["xs","sm","md","lg","xl","xxl"],x=y.forwardRef((e,c)=>{const{getPrefixCls:$,direction:t}=y.useContext(W.E_),{gutter:n,wrap:h,supportFlexGap:O}=y.useContext(B.Z),{prefixCls:S,span:D,order:T,offset:w,push:A,pull:L,className:H,children:f,flex:r,style:E}=e,m=U(e,["prefixCls","span","order","offset","push","pull","className","children","flex","style"]),a=$("col",S),[_,p]=(0,M.c)(a);let v={};G.forEach(i=>{let s={};const u=e[i];typeof u=="number"?s.span=u:typeof u=="object"&&(s=u||{}),delete m[i],v=Object.assign(Object.assign({},v),{[`${a}-${i}-${s.span}`]:s.span!==void 0,[`${a}-${i}-order-${s.order}`]:s.order||s.order===0,[`${a}-${i}-offset-${s.offset}`]:s.offset||s.offset===0,[`${a}-${i}-push-${s.push}`]:s.push||s.push===0,[`${a}-${i}-pull-${s.pull}`]:s.pull||s.pull===0,[`${a}-${i}-flex-${s.flex}`]:s.flex||s.flex==="auto",[`${a}-rtl`]:t==="rtl"})});const d=I()(a,{[`${a}-${D}`]:D!==void 0,[`${a}-order-${T}`]:T,[`${a}-offset-${w}`]:w,[`${a}-push-${A}`]:A,[`${a}-pull-${L}`]:L},H,v,p),g={};if(n&&n[0]>0){const i=n[0]/2;g.paddingLeft=i,g.paddingRight=i}if(n&&n[1]>0&&!O){const i=n[1]/2;g.paddingTop=i,g.paddingBottom=i}return r&&(g.flex=F(r),h===!1&&!g.minWidth&&(g.minWidth=0)),_(y.createElement("div",Object.assign({},m,{style:Object.assign(Object.assign({},g),E),className:d,ref:c}),f))});C.Z=x},20577:function(Z,C,o){var l=o(84875),I=o.n(l),y=o(93236),W=o(81731),B=o(5366),M=o(99272),U=o(70151),F=o(82678),G=function(t,n){var h={};for(var O in t)Object.prototype.hasOwnProperty.call(t,O)&&n.indexOf(O)<0&&(h[O]=t[O]);if(t!=null&&typeof Object.getOwnPropertySymbols=="function")for(var S=0,O=Object.getOwnPropertySymbols(t);S<O.length;S++)n.indexOf(O[S])<0&&Object.prototype.propertyIsEnumerable.call(t,O[S])&&(h[O[S]]=t[O[S]]);return h};const x=null,e=null;function c(t,n){const[h,O]=y.useState(typeof t=="string"?t:""),S=()=>{if(typeof t=="string"&&O(t),typeof t=="object")for(let D=0;D<M.c.length;D++){const T=M.c[D];if(!n[T])continue;const w=t[T];if(w!==void 0){O(w);return}}};return y.useEffect(()=>{S()},[JSON.stringify(t),n]),h}const $=y.forwardRef((t,n)=>{const{prefixCls:h,justify:O,align:S,className:D,style:T,children:w,gutter:A=0,wrap:L}=t,H=G(t,["prefixCls","justify","align","className","style","children","gutter","wrap"]),{getPrefixCls:f,direction:r}=y.useContext(W.E_),[E,m]=y.useState({xs:!0,sm:!0,md:!0,lg:!0,xl:!0,xxl:!0}),[a,_]=y.useState({xs:!1,sm:!1,md:!1,lg:!1,xl:!1,xxl:!1}),p=c(S,a),v=c(O,a),d=(0,B.Z)(),g=y.useRef(A),i=(0,M.Z)();y.useEffect(()=>{const K=i.subscribe(Q=>{_(Q);const j=g.current||0;(!Array.isArray(j)&&typeof j=="object"||Array.isArray(j)&&(typeof j[0]=="object"||typeof j[1]=="object"))&&m(Q)});return()=>i.unsubscribe(K)},[]);const s=()=>{const K=[void 0,void 0];return(Array.isArray(A)?A:[A,void 0]).forEach((j,te)=>{if(typeof j=="object")for(let q=0;q<M.c.length;q++){const ee=M.c[q];if(E[ee]&&j[ee]!==void 0){K[te]=j[ee];break}}else K[te]=j}),K},u=f("row",h),[V,X]=(0,F.V)(u),P=s(),Y=I()(u,{[`${u}-no-wrap`]:L===!1,[`${u}-${v}`]:v,[`${u}-${p}`]:p,[`${u}-rtl`]:r==="rtl"},D,X),N={},R=P[0]!=null&&P[0]>0?P[0]/-2:void 0,b=P[1]!=null&&P[1]>0?P[1]/-2:void 0;R&&(N.marginLeft=R,N.marginRight=R),d?[,N.rowGap]=P:b&&(N.marginTop=b,N.marginBottom=b);const[z,J]=P,k=y.useMemo(()=>({gutter:[z,J],wrap:L,supportFlexGap:d}),[z,J,L,d]);return V(y.createElement(U.Z.Provider,{value:k},y.createElement("div",Object.assign({},H,{className:Y,style:Object.assign(Object.assign({},N),T),ref:n}),w)))});C.Z=$},82678:function(Z,C,o){o.d(C,{V:function(){return F},c:function(){return G}});var l=o(3560),I=o(46432);const y=x=>{const{componentCls:e}=x;return{[e]:{display:"flex",flexFlow:"row wrap",minWidth:0,"&::before, &::after":{display:"flex"},"&-no-wrap":{flexWrap:"nowrap"},"&-start":{justifyContent:"flex-start"},"&-center":{justifyContent:"center"},"&-end":{justifyContent:"flex-end"},"&-space-between":{justifyContent:"space-between"},"&-space-around":{justifyContent:"space-around"},"&-space-evenly":{justifyContent:"space-evenly"},"&-top":{alignItems:"flex-start"},"&-middle":{alignItems:"center"},"&-bottom":{alignItems:"flex-end"}}}},W=x=>{const{componentCls:e}=x;return{[e]:{position:"relative",maxWidth:"100%",minHeight:1}}},B=(x,e)=>{const{componentCls:c,gridColumns:$}=x,t={};for(let n=$;n>=0;n--)n===0?(t[`${c}${e}-${n}`]={display:"none"},t[`${c}-push-${n}`]={insetInlineStart:"auto"},t[`${c}-pull-${n}`]={insetInlineEnd:"auto"},t[`${c}${e}-push-${n}`]={insetInlineStart:"auto"},t[`${c}${e}-pull-${n}`]={insetInlineEnd:"auto"},t[`${c}${e}-offset-${n}`]={marginInlineStart:0},t[`${c}${e}-order-${n}`]={order:0}):(t[`${c}${e}-${n}`]={display:"block",flex:`0 0 ${n/$*100}%`,maxWidth:`${n/$*100}%`},t[`${c}${e}-push-${n}`]={insetInlineStart:`${n/$*100}%`},t[`${c}${e}-pull-${n}`]={insetInlineEnd:`${n/$*100}%`},t[`${c}${e}-offset-${n}`]={marginInlineStart:`${n/$*100}%`},t[`${c}${e}-order-${n}`]={order:n});return t},M=(x,e)=>B(x,e),U=(x,e,c)=>({[`@media (min-width: ${e}px)`]:Object.assign({},M(x,c))}),F=(0,l.Z)("Grid",x=>[y(x)]),G=(0,l.Z)("Grid",x=>{const e=(0,I.TS)(x,{gridColumns:24}),c={"-sm":e.screenSMMin,"-md":e.screenMDMin,"-lg":e.screenLGMin,"-xl":e.screenXLMin,"-xxl":e.screenXXLMin};return[W(e),M(e,""),M(e,"-xs"),Object.keys(c).map($=>U(e,c[$],$)).reduce(($,t)=>Object.assign(Object.assign({},$),t),{})]})},63647:function(Z,C,o){var l=o(20577);C.Z=l.Z},40141:function(Z,C,o){o.d(C,{Z:function(){return H}});var l=o(93236),I=o(19257),y=o(99188),W=o(84875),B=o.n(W),M=o(81731),U=o(63157),G=f=>{const{value:r,formatter:E,precision:m,decimalSeparator:a,groupSeparator:_="",prefixCls:p}=f;let v;if(typeof E=="function")v=E(r);else{const d=String(r),g=d.match(/^(-?)(\d*)(\.(\d+))?$/);if(!g||d==="-")v=d;else{const i=g[1];let s=g[2]||"0",u=g[4]||"";s=s.replace(/\B(?=(\d{3})+(?!\d))/g,_),typeof m=="number"&&(u=u.padEnd(m,"0").slice(0,m>0?m:0)),u&&(u=`${a}${u}`),v=[l.createElement("span",{key:"int",className:`${p}-content-value-int`},i,s),u&&l.createElement("span",{key:"decimal",className:`${p}-content-value-decimal`},u)]}}return l.createElement("span",{className:`${p}-content-value`},v)},x=o(16799),e=o(3560),c=o(46432);const $=f=>{const{componentCls:r,marginXXS:E,padding:m,colorTextDescription:a,titleFontSize:_,colorTextHeading:p,contentFontSize:v,fontFamily:d}=f;return{[`${r}`]:Object.assign(Object.assign({},(0,x.Wf)(f)),{[`${r}-title`]:{marginBottom:E,color:a,fontSize:_},[`${r}-skeleton`]:{paddingTop:m},[`${r}-content`]:{color:p,fontSize:v,fontFamily:d,[`${r}-content-value`]:{display:"inline-block",direction:"ltr"},[`${r}-content-prefix, ${r}-content-suffix`]:{display:"inline-block"},[`${r}-content-prefix`]:{marginInlineEnd:E},[`${r}-content-suffix`]:{marginInlineStart:E}}})}};var t=(0,e.Z)("Statistic",f=>{const r=(0,c.TS)(f,{});return[$(r)]},f=>{const{fontSizeHeading3:r,fontSize:E}=f;return{titleFontSize:E,contentFontSize:r}}),h=f=>{const{prefixCls:r,className:E,rootClassName:m,style:a,valueStyle:_,value:p=0,title:v,valueRender:d,prefix:g,suffix:i,loading:s=!1,onMouseEnter:u,onMouseLeave:V,decimalSeparator:X=".",groupSeparator:P=","}=f,{getPrefixCls:Y,direction:N,statistic:R}=l.useContext(M.E_),b=Y("statistic",r),[z,J]=t(b),k=l.createElement(G,Object.assign({decimalSeparator:X,groupSeparator:P,prefixCls:b},f,{value:p})),K=B()(b,{[`${b}-rtl`]:N==="rtl"},R==null?void 0:R.className,E,m,J);return z(l.createElement("div",{className:K,style:Object.assign(Object.assign({},R==null?void 0:R.style),a),onMouseEnter:u,onMouseLeave:V},v&&l.createElement("div",{className:`${b}-title`},v),l.createElement(U.Z,{paragraph:!1,loading:s,className:`${b}-skeleton`},l.createElement("div",{style:_,className:`${b}-content`},g&&l.createElement("span",{className:`${b}-content-prefix`},g),d?d(k):k,i&&l.createElement("span",{className:`${b}-content-suffix`},i)))))};const O=[["Y",1e3*60*60*24*365],["M",1e3*60*60*24*30],["D",1e3*60*60*24],["H",1e3*60*60],["m",1e3*60],["s",1e3],["S",1]];function S(f,r){let E=f;const m=/\[[^\]]*]/g,a=(r.match(m)||[]).map(d=>d.slice(1,-1)),_=r.replace(m,"[]"),p=O.reduce((d,g)=>{let[i,s]=g;if(d.includes(i)){const u=Math.floor(E/s);return E-=u*s,d.replace(new RegExp(`${i}+`,"g"),V=>{const X=V.length;return u.toString().padStart(X,"0")})}return d},_);let v=0;return p.replace(m,()=>{const d=a[v];return v+=1,d})}function D(f,r){const{format:E=""}=r,m=new Date(f).getTime(),a=Date.now(),_=Math.max(m-a,0);return S(_,E)}const T=1e3/30;function w(f){return new Date(f).getTime()}const A=f=>{const{value:r,format:E="HH:mm:ss",onChange:m,onFinish:a}=f,_=(0,I.Z)(),p=l.useRef(null),v=()=>{a==null||a(),p.current&&(clearInterval(p.current),p.current=null)},d=()=>{const s=w(r);s>=Date.now()&&(p.current=setInterval(()=>{_(),m==null||m(s-Date.now()),s<Date.now()&&v()},T))};l.useEffect(()=>(d(),()=>{p.current&&(clearInterval(p.current),p.current=null)}),[r]);const g=(s,u)=>D(s,Object.assign(Object.assign({},u),{format:E})),i=s=>(0,y.Tm)(s,{title:void 0});return l.createElement(h,Object.assign({},f,{valueRender:i,formatter:g}))};var L=l.memo(A);h.Countdown=L;var H=h}}]);
|